Can I print barcodes using Excel?
I would like to convert a number in an Excel cell to barcode and print it in
spreadsheet form. Are there add-ins or 3rd party software available to do this? |
The easiest way to print a bar code in an Excel spreadsheet would be
to use a bar code ActiveX control. The best one on the market is available from TAL Technologies. You can get more information and download a demo from the following URL: http://www.taltech.com/products/activex_barcodes.html The demo version of the TAL Bar Code ActiveX control comes complete with a sample Excel spreadsheet that demonstrates how to use it in Excel.
